This compression ratio calculator can be used to work out the compression ratio of your engine. The compression ratio is the ratio between two elements: the gas volume in the cylinder with the piston at its highest point (top dead center of the stroke, TDC), and the gas volume with the piston at its lowest point (bottom dead center of the stroke, BDC)

· Naval Brass 464 – UNS C46400 . UNS C46400 – Naval Brass is copper alloyed with zinc and tin to provide improved strength, corrosion resistance and machinability. Naval brass is classified as CopperZincTin Alloys (Tin Brasses). It's nominally composed of 60% copper, % zinc and % tin.
